Expanding Medicare support in response to Omicron
www.mbsonline.gov.au• The Australian Government has temporarily expanded telehealth support to GPs, OMPs and their patients in response to the Omicron variant. • MBS items 92746 (for GPs) and 92747 (for OMPs) will be available until 30 June 2022 for practitioners ... the equivalent rebate for a Level C consultation undertaken by a GP or OMP.

MBS COVID-19 Vaccine Booster Incentive payment
www.mbsonline.gov.auMBS item 93666 is being implemented to provide an incentive payment of $10 per eligible vaccine suitability assessment service to patients receiving a COVID-19 booster vaccination. MBS item 93666 will be paid in conjunction with COVID-19 Vaccine Suitability Assessment Service MBS items for second or subsequent doses, namely 93644, 93645, 93646 ...
